Enjoying the outdoors

Nearly 7 in 10 Canadians participated in outdoor or wilderness activities, some in more than one, in 2016.

Source: General Social Survey (Canadians at Work and Home), 2016.

When life gives you lemons

126,732,450 kg - The amount of lemons and limes, fresh or dried imported to Canada, in 2019.

Source: Table 990-0008 8. Imports – Edible fruit and nuts; peel of citrus fruit of melons.

Sun protection

24,791,485 - The number of sunglasses imported in Canada in 2019.

Source: Table 990-0090 90. Imports – Optical, photographic, cinematographic, measuring, checking, precision, medical or surgical instruments and apparatus; parts and accessories thereof.

33% - The percentage of adult Canadians reported a sunburn, in the past year.

Source: Pinault L, Fioletov V. Sun exposure, sun protection and sunburn among Canadian adults. Health Reports 2017; 28(5): 12-19.

Cool treats

4.21 L - The quantity of ice cream available for consumption per person in Canada, in 2019.

Source: Table 32-10-0054-01 Food available in Canada.
